SUMMARY:Wiki-a-thon  to support BIPOC Scientists and Engineers
DESCRIPTION:Wikipedia overwhelmingly recognizes the achievements of white people. Join us as we add wikipedia pages for BIPOC leaders in science and technology\, highlighting their often overlooked accomplishments and ensuring that the next generation can see role models who look like them. \n\n\n\nNo experience is necessary – just bring a laptop! \n\n\n\n\nWe will provide a list of scientists who don’t yet have pages\, or you can come up with your own! The event will begin with a short training on how to edit Wikipedia\, followed by time to write your own article on a scientist\, engineer\, or technologist of your choice. \nRSVP here \nPlease RSVP above for a Zoom link if you will be attending virtually\, or to let us know that you are coming in person.
